  "account": "Vertex Pharmaceuticals Incorporated, a Boston-based biotech company valued at $139 billion, focuses on developing therapies for serious diseases, particularly cystic fibrosis (CF). As a large-cap stock, VRTX commands significant influence within the biotechnology industry, holding a global monopoly in CF treatments with its blockbuster drug Trikafta/Katori. However, VRTX experienced a slight decline of 1.4% from its 52-week high of $555.69, achieved on August 25. Despite this setback, VRTX stock demonstrated a 30.1% gain over the past three months, trailing behind the VanEck Biotech ETF's (BBH) 32% growth during the same period. The company's stock rose 21.9% year-to-date and climbed 37.9% over the past 52 weeks, underperforming BBH's YTD gains of 26.8% and its own 44.3% return over the last year. VRTX's bullish trend persisted, with the stock trading above its 200-day moving average since early December 2025 and its 50-day moving average since early June. Despite commercialization hurdles for new treatments like Journavx and Casgevy, pipeline setbacks including the discontinuation of VX-993, and regulatory pricing scrutiny, VRTX still managed to beat earnings estimates for Q2, reporting adjusted EPS of $4.73 against Wall Street's expectation of $4.79 and revenue of $3.3 billion, surpassing forecasts of $3.2 billion. Analysts remain generally optimistic about VRTX's prospects, assigning a Moderate Buy rating to the stock with a mean price target of $566.65, indicating a potential upside of 3.5% from current levels.",
